A passport is essential for travel within Spain (unless you are from an EU country) and must be applied for well in advance, generally in your home country. All travellers to Spain except EU nationals visiting from other EU countries, must have a passport which is valid until after you return home. EU citizens do not need a valid passport, a national identity card is sufficient. Citizens of Australia, Canada, New Zealand, and the United States need only a valid passport to enter Spain for stays of up to 90 days (i.e no visa is required).
All other nationals should consult the relevant embassies about visa requirements. Tourists are permitted to stay in the country for three months, for longer periods inquiries must be made at Spanish consulates abroad. For those that do require visas, they do have a use by date and you can be refused entry once this date has elapsed.
Make two photocopies of your passport's data page -- one to be kept by someone at home and another for you to carry with you but keep separate from your passport. If you lose your passport, promptly call the nearest embassy or consulate and the local police.
